Can I use the Spray Mop on walls and vertical surfaces?Updated 20 days ago

Spray Mop isn’t just for floors. It can also be used vertically, making it a handy tool for cleaning a range of upright surfaces around the home.

What you can clean vertically

You can use the mop vertically on:

  • Painted walls
  • Doors and door frames
  • Skirting boards
  • Tiles and splashbacks
  • Cupboard fronts and wardrobes

This is especially useful for general wash-downs, end-of-lease cleans, or removing everyday dust and marks.

How to use it safely

  • Lightly mist your cleaner onto the mop pad or use the spray function sparingly
  • Always start with a spot test in an inconspicuous area, especially on painted surfaces
  • Use gentle pressure and smooth, upward or downward motions
  • Rinse or wipe over with clean water if needed

Good to know

While the mop works well vertically, it’s best suited for light to moderate cleaning rather than heavy scrubbing. For delicate or freshly painted walls, take extra care and avoid oversaturating the surface.

For more control, you can also use the Atomiser Spray Bottle to apply a fine mist. This is ideal for vertical surfaces like painted walls and helps prevent oversaturation while allowing more precise application of Universal Cleaner.
